2021-22 Men's Basketball Preview

The last time we saw the Penn State Mont Alto Men's Basketball team, it was fresh off a PSUAC conference title and a loss in the USCAA Consolation game. The season ended with a 24-6 overall record and a 17-2 conference record. Looking ahead to this upcoming season, some key pieces return from that conference championship team, and some new leaders will need to emerge to build upon that momentum.

 

KEY RETURNERS:

#1 QUINTYN FLEMISTER

 

Two-time all PSUAC member Quintyn Flemister is looking to add to an already polished career. He has seen his points per game rise from 8.7 in his freshman season to 13.3 two seasons ago. He was the second leading scorer on the 2019 squad and will be looked upon for his offense this season. Quintyn was named the 2018 Defensive Player of the Year and 2019 PSUAC Western Division Player of the Year. Coach Schenzel says that Quintyn is a great leader on the court in so many facets and is a regular on the dean's list. He is interested to see what he can accomplish in his final season here at Mont Alto.

 

POINTS REBOUNDS ASSISTS STEALS
13.3 5.7 3.7 2.9

 

#22 JOHN TEAGUE

John Teague was the second leading scorer from 2019-20 with 12.3 PPG. John has great size at 6'7" and 255 pounds. He was the focal point during the PSUAC Championship run and can be an excellent two-way player. The best part about his game is that he has excellent footwork and quickness. John also has a knack for toughness that was developed during his football playing years. He has a nice skillset for a big man with a 15 foot jumper and a wide variety of around the basket moves.

 

POINTS REBOUNDS ASSISTS BLOCKS
12.3 8.7 0.5 1.2

 

#3 CAM WILLIAMS

Cam Williams is another key piece returning to this year's team. Cam averaged 7.3 PPG in 2019-20 and 5.3 rebounds per game and 2.6 assists per game. Cam is a great athlete with a very high basketball IQ. As a freshman, he was a defensive stopper and a very good ball handler. Cam has expanded his scoring in the offseason to include all three levels and is a very good floor general.

 

POINTS REBOUNDS ASSISTS STEALS
7.3 5.3 2.6 1.7

 

#2 DARRIUS BUSH

Darrius Bush is the next returner top scorer for 2021-22. He is a 6'5" athletic player who can create offense for both himself and his teammates. Darrius has very deep shooting range and a great feel for the game at the guard position. In 2019, he averaged 7.8 PPG, 4.2 RPG and 1.8 APG. He has really picked up his play on the defensive end to be a two-way threat.

 

POINTS REBOUNDS ASSISTS BLOCKS
7.8 4.2 1.8 0.6

 

NEWCOMERS 

#5 JAYLEN POOLER

Pooler is a freshman with a great offensive feel. He has great range and consistency on his jumper and has the tools to get to the rim. He is a great passer and can be a pass first guy. He is developing on the defensive end and has shown great quickness and toughness on that end of the court.

 

#11 SHAWN LEWIS

Shawn Lewis is a 5'8" point guard who is very tough and pesky on the defensive end. He comes from a basketball family and understands the game. He is great at reading screens on offense as a point guard. At Central Dauphin East, he was a second team All Mid-Penn conference selection last season.

 

#23 CALEB ECKERT

Caleb Eckert comes to Penn State Mont Alto as a 2,000-point scorer in high school and has won multiple league MVP awards. At 6'7" he has guard skills with a frame that is getting stronger by the day. For a freshman, he has a high basketball IQ. He has shown the ability to time blocks on the defensive end and to be an effective two-way player. He set a career-high in points last season in a game with a 46-point performance.
